Environment Canada is cautioning Ontarians about severe weather headed our way in the next 48 hours. With a mostly clear day expected in central Ontario Monday, the northern regions of Ontario can expect thunderstorms, high winds and wretched weather in the next 24-hours. The weather will then make a sharp right and head down over our area, bringing the wrath of the weather gods upon us.

“Confidence is growing in an early season severe thunderstorm event with strong winds and large hail possible,” Environment Canada says on their social media pages. While golfers may want to risk an early morning game Tuesday, others may want to ensure their emergency preparedness kits are well stocked and handy.
